Output 4585292ac620dc964f8081de5a07fe65d3a0be408c8033471db55b070714040e:0

value
8646373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03d133863146cf5032132f3d438aca93c783eaa OP_EQUAL
address
3N8gT5s4BvmUosfiMPMKbzWjTm4eNNpJju
transaction
4585292ac620dc964f8081de5a07fe65d3a0be408c8033471db55b070714040e
spent
true